Help Phone app modification

So what I wanted to do was change the lg default background during a phone call to the android stock gradient as i prefer the look of it better. I extracted the phone.apk out of the /system/app directory and found that the gradiant images are already there. so my question is, why is the phone not using these images and how do i change it so it does. My first thought was a metamorph theme that only changed the phone app but seeing as the images are already there i guess theres no point.
 
When you extract the apk in the res folder is there the default background?

If so you can save the gradient background under the name of the default, this should cause the gradient one to be displayed.

Just make sure they are the same dimensions
 
well i made a metamorph theme to modify the phone.apk only and used the gradient i extracted in it. it applys but doesnt actually change it. it still shows the default lg color. does your luna theme actually change the phone call background? if so i could start with that instead

Edit- Well i applied the phone.apk part of the luna2 theme as it has a phone call background and it looks as if there is a slightly smaller rectangle than the size of the screen the same color as the default over top of the luna backgroung because i can see the outer edges. is there something else i should be editing to get the background to show during a phone call?
 
snap20100912214253.png


See how there is that grey around the contact image that seems to be covering up the background, which can be seem as a thin line around the left and right?

I think this grey is to blame, I am currently looking for the png for it so we can replace it with a transparency, I looked in the luna theme for phone.apk and it does add backgrounds, they just seem to be covered up, this may be in some other apk Ill try and nail; it down
 
yea thats exactly what im talking about lol how the background gets covered up. i changed the image_bg.png to transparent because it has the same color as the rectangle and it didnt help at all
